Between the noise and silence The essence of existence These are very simple, even minimalistic melodies. This is the soothing, meditative guitar of Australian musician Peter Miller. His album "From a Distant Shore" reminded me of Windham Hill's legendary artists like William Ackerman and Michael Hedges. But Peter Miller definitely has his own unique style when he plays his guitar without accompaniment ("Wednesday Night Jam") or adds the hypnotic sounds of didgeridoo and anxious noises of a storm to his music ("Chase the Wind"). Peter Miller's inspired guitar performance has astonishing freshness. Each instrumental composition is an exciting story which carries away the listener from the beginning to the end. My favorite track on the "From a Distant Shore" album is the penetrating "Somewhere in the Hills". Peter Miller's music has a many nuances and must be listened to attentively.
